Some braille printers require perforated ... WebThe basic braille alphabet, braille numbers, braille punctuation and special symbols characters are constructed from six dots. These braille dots are positioned like the figure six on a die, in a grid of two parallel vertical lines of three dots each. The braille script designed by Louis Braille uses tactile patterns made with six raised dots arranged in a 3 x 2 matrix, called the braille cell. One or more braille cells may represent a letter, number, punctuation or a symbol. The following table shows the Unicode Braille characters representing various braille ... Braille is a tactile system that allows blind and partially sighted people to access literacy by reading and writing. Braille is read by touch, by using the pads of the fingers to feel the letters and symbols.
